Jessica & Matthew

3rd October 2025Cooling Castle Barn

Jessica and Matthew were married on 3rd October 2025 at Cooling Castle Barn in Kent. From the very beginning, their wedding day felt deeply personal – full of thoughtful details, genuine emotion, and the kind of laughter that comes from a room full of people who truly know and love the couple at the centre of it all.

Morning preparations

The day began at Cooling Castle Barn with Jessica getting ready on site alongside her bridesmaids. The atmosphere in the morning was calm, warm and full of anticipation – the kind of energy that builds quietly before a big moment. There was laughter, nervous excitement, and the occasional pause where everything seemed to sink in.

One of the most memorable parts of the morning came through the exchange of gifts. As well as thoughtful presents shared between Jessica and Matthew, there were also gifts for the bridal party – moments that brought real, unfiltered reactions and set an emotional tone for the day ahead.

What made the morning truly unique, though, was something none of us had ever seen done in quite this way before. Alongside a handwritten letter, Matthew surprised Jessica with a full video message – a deeply personal film he had carefully planned, written and recorded just for her. Rather than a few spoken words, this was a beautifully crafted journey through their relationship, told entirely in Matthew’s own voice.

The video traced their story from the very beginning – from the day they first met in January 2022, through early dates, family weddings, anniversaries, trips away, and the everyday moments that quietly build a life together. It led all the way up to Matthew’s proposal in New York, a moment that clearly meant the world to both of them. Watching Jessica experience that video was incredibly moving – the room fell silent, and there were tears, smiles, and laughter all at once. It was one of those moments that perfectly captured who they are as a couple.

The ceremony

The ceremony took place at Cooling Castle Barn and was led by celebrant Martin, with Sarah acting as registrar. It struck a perfect balance between heartfelt and relaxed, with moments of emotion sitting naturally alongside gentle humour and warmth.

As Jessica made her way into the ceremony space and joined Matthew at the front, there was a noticeable shift in the room – that collective breath everyone seems to take when the moment truly arrives. The vows were spoken with sincerity and confidence, and as rings were exchanged, you could see just how grounded and sure they were in one another.

The ceremony ended with a huge round of applause as Jessica and Matthew were pronounced husband and wife, and from that point on, the day moved effortlessly into celebration.

Speeches

The speeches were one of the standout parts of the day – long, entertaining, emotional, and full of personality. Each one added another layer to Jessica and Matthew’s story, and together they painted a brilliant picture of the couple they are and the life they’re building.

Jessica’s father, Kevin, opened the speeches with warmth and humour. He spoke proudly of all his daughters and shared stories from Jessica’s life that had the room laughing out loud. One particularly memorable moment involved Jessica’s very first driving lesson – a Renault Clio, a humpback bridge, and all four wheels briefly leaving the ground. Beyond the laughter, Kevin spoke movingly about watching Jessica and Matthew during their vows, describing it as one of the clearest and most genuine displays of love he’d ever seen at a wedding.

Matthew’s father, Mark, followed with a heartfelt speech full of pride and affection. He spoke about the dedication Jessica and Matthew had shown in planning their day, often after long days at work, and how naturally compatible they are. Mark reflected on how Jessica brought warmth, energy and life into their home, and how impossible it is not to be drawn in by her personality. His words were honest and emotional, and it was clear how proud he is of them both.

Best men Louis and Tom then took over and completely changed the pace – delivering a brilliantly funny speech packed with quick wit, playful roasting, and perfectly timed one-liners. Matthew’s love of Liverpool FC became a running theme, along with affectionate jokes about his habits and quirks. The room was in stitches throughout, but beneath the humour was a genuine affection and loyalty that shone through. They finished by raising a glass to Jessica for choosing Matthew, and to Matthew for somehow “punching above his weight”, which brought the house down.

Matthew closed the speeches with a deeply emotional and sincere thank you. He began by acknowledging loved ones who could not be there in person, before thanking both families for their unwavering support. He spoke warmly about Jessica’s parents for welcoming him into their family, and about his own parents for their constant love and guidance.

He also paid tribute to the bridesmaids and best men, thanking them for everything they had done in the build-up to the wedding. But the heart of his speech was reserved for Jessica. Matthew spoke about how they met, how everything felt right from the very beginning, and how grateful he is for her strength, kindness and unwavering support – particularly through more challenging times. It was honest, vulnerable, and incredibly moving, and it ended with a promise of forever that said everything that needed to be said.
